So I'm about to start building a winch, and was looking at a TAV2 for sale...


It says its a 3/4" bore and comes with a #35 or #40/41 sprocket????

Is this the right one for a 6.5 hp engine?

Also how many teeth are on those sprockets? Confused

Depends on the shaft of your engine. What size is it..if its an inch then your gonna want the inch bore tav2 if its 3/4 then your gonna want the 3/4 tav2.

The Tav2 has a 12 tooth sprocket,for a #35 chain. Your gonna need to buy another additional sprocket perferbly 60 tooth.
